Email received : "I 1st went to Lijiang in 1992 fell in love with it and since 2001 have been going there on a regular basis (2 - 3 months a year). I thus have been able to observe the "evolution" for the worse of this once indeed charming town. During the day the center of the Old Town has become a giant supermarket (everybody selling the same thing) and during the night it changes into a giant bar and disco, techno music blarding away, people getting drunk, prostitution proliferating and yet, I was told, Lijiang received a medal from Unesco for its model and respectful upkeep of a World Heritage town! Is this a joke? What exactly is required of a World Heritage place? I am appalled! What happened" ?
Brief description
Source : http://whc.unesco.org/en/list/811
The Old Town of Lijiang, which is perfectly adapted to the uneven topography of this key commercial and strategic site, has retained a historic townscape of high quality and authenticity. Its architecture is noteworthy for the blending of elements from several cultures that have come together over many centuries. Lijiang also possesses an ancient water-supply system of great complexity and ingenuity that still functions effectively today.
